    Watched the Ivory Coast - Japan game last night.

    Ivory Coast were poor right up until Didier Drogba came on as substitute. Within five minutes Ivory Coast had turned it around and were leading 2-1. Drogba didn't even play part in the goals but there was a massive lift in the spirits of the Ivory Coast team the moment he stepped on to the pitch.
    That is the power of the man that he doesn't even need to do anything to get players around him to play better.

    And if you're interested to know how our other old boy got on, Kalou was his usual self. Some good moments, no end product.
